Posted June 7, 20178 yr Hello, I made a mod, that adds shield enchantments, but the problem with them is shields can't be enchanted by vanilla ways, because their enchantability is 0. The getItemEnchantability() for shields returns always 0, not a variable. Is there any way, how to change it (without adding my own shield, that will replace vanilla one)? Thanks for any help
June 9, 20178 yr On 6/7/2017 at 3:07 PM, fcelon said: The getItemEnchantability() for shields returns always 0, not a variable. Is there any way, how to change it (without adding my own shield, that will replace vanilla one)? Sounds like substitution, which is buggy and probably only for blocks (not items). Ideas: 1) Accept that you will need to extend the shield class. 2) Maybe you can trap events to inject your shield in place of vanilla shields (i.e. when crafted, when picked up). 3) You could replace the enchanting table and/or anvil (or trap events entering each) so you can add your exception for shields. December 25, 20186 yr On 6/9/2017 at 3:44 PM, Draco18s said: You can replace items. https://github.com/Draco18s/ReasonableRealism/blob/master/src/main/java/com/draco18s/farming/FarmingBase.java#L143 How would you do this in 1.12.2? GameRegistry.addSubstitutionAlias method doesn't exist anymore
December 26, 20186 yr Register the item with the vanilla prefix. That's it.
